Preparing the RV for Decor

The first step in decorating a small RV interior is to prepare the space. Start by cleaning the interior thoroughly. Remove any dust and debris, and vacuum the floors and furnishings. Make sure to get into all of the nooks and crannies, as dust can accumulate in these areas. Once the interior is clean, you can move on to the next step.

Next, inspect the walls and floors for any damage. If there are any cracks, chips, or other imperfections, make sure to repair them before decorating. You may also want to consider painting the interior walls or replacing any old flooring.

Finally, take some time to declutter the interior. Remove any unnecessary items and store them away. This will help create a more open and inviting space for decorating.

Choosing Decor Elements

When it comes to decorating a small RV interior, it’s important to choose decor elements that are both functional and stylish. Stick to items that are lightweight and easy to move around, as this will make it easier to rearrange the interior as needed.

When selecting furniture, look for pieces that have multiple uses. For example, an ottoman that doubles as a storage container is a great way to maximize space. Additionally, choose furniture that is easy to move around, as this will make it easier to rearrange the interior.

When it comes to color, stick to neutral shades that are light and airy. This will help create a more open and inviting space. Additionally, add some bright and bold colors with decorative items such as pillows, rugs, and artwork.

Arranging the Interior

Now that you’ve chosen the decor elements, it’s time to start arranging the interior. Start by placing the furniture in the center of the room. This will create an open and inviting space that is easy to move around.

Next, add any decorative items such as pillows, rugs, and artwork. These items can help add color and texture to the interior. Additionally, consider adding some plants or other greenery to add a pop of color and life to the space.

Finally, take some time to organize and store items away. This will help create a more open and inviting space. Use baskets, bins, and shelves to store items away and keep the interior clutter-free.

Finishing Touches

Once the interior is arranged, it’s time to add the finishing touches. Start by adding some lighting to the space. This will help create a cozy and inviting atmosphere. Additionally, add some artwork or photographs to the walls to add a personal touch.

Finally, add some personal items such as books, trinkets, and other items that will make the RV feel like home. This will help create a more inviting and comfortable space.
